摘要
An imbalance between oxidants and antioxidants generates the oxidative stress. Oxidative stress is the major cause of many diseases like cardiovascular, respiratory disease, renal diseases, neurological diseases, cancer, and aging. Cardiovascular complications are the leading cause of mortality in patients so the purpose of this review is to evaluate the effectiveness of N-acetylcysteine (NAC) in the treatment of cardiovascular diseases. N-acetylcysteine is an antioxidant which confers its protective effect by minimizing oxidative stress and oxidative stress associated problems. A search using the Pub Med database was conducted using the keywords N-acetylcysteine and mice heart. All research articles related to the use of N-acetylcysteine in protection of mice heart were discussed. A total of 93 articles were identified during this broad search while 30 articles were included for review recommending the N-acetylcysteine for protection of heart. This review proved that N-acetylcysteine has a positive role in management of multiple heart diseases.
